In an atom of argon (atomic number 18), the valence electrons are found in the 3s and 3p sublevels. Specifically, argon has a complete outer shell with the electron configuration of 1s² 2s² 2p⁶ 3s² 3p⁶. Therefore, the valence electrons are the two electrons in the 3s sublevel and the six electrons in the 3p sublevel, totaling eight valence electrons.

The valence electrons in an atom of nitrogen (N) are found in the 2s and 2p sublevels. There are a total of 5 valence electrons in nitrogen, with 2 in the 2s sublevel and 3 in the 2p sublevel.

Nitrogen has 2 core electrons and 5 valence electrons. If you remember, nitrogen has an atomic number of 7. When an atom is neutral it has an equal number of protons and electrons. Therfore, the overal number of electrons is 7. The definition of core electrons is, electrons in their most inner shell, On the other hand valence electrons are electrons in the outermostshell. When looking at a periodic table you see that there is a total# of 5 valence electrons. In order to figure out the core number you subtract the total number of electrons(atomic #) - Valence # of electrons. I hope this helped :)
